在现代软件开发中,使用版本控制工具如GitHub已成为一种标准实践。IntelliJ IDEA(通常简称为IDEA)是一款功能强大的集成开发环境,它为开发者提供了非常便捷的GitHub项目加载功能。本文将详细介绍如何在IDEA中加载GitHub项目,包括具体的操作步骤、常见问题以及注意事项。
1. 什么是IDEA?
IntelliJ IDEA是一款由JetBrains开发的IDE,主要用于Java和其他语言的开发。它支持GitHub的集成,使得开发者能够轻松管理和使用来自GitHub的项目。使用IDEA,可以有效提高开发效率,并享受智能代码补全、实时错误检查等功能。
2. 在IDEA中加载GitHub项目的前期准备
在开始之前,需要确保以下条件满足:
- 安装IntelliJ IDEA:确保你已经安装了最新版本的IDEA。
- Git客户端:需要安装Git并配置到系统环境变量中。
- GitHub账户:需要有一个有效的GitHub账户。
- 项目的GitHub链接:确保你获取了你想要加载的GitHub项目的URL。
3. 在IDEA中加载GitHub项目的步骤
以下是详细的步骤,指导你如何在IDEA中加载GitHub项目:
3.1 打开IDEA
首先,启动你的IDEA。通常会看到欢迎界面,点击“Get from VCS”选项。
3.2 选择VCS选项
在弹出的窗口中,选择“Git”作为版本控制系统(VCS)。
3.3 输入项目URL
在“Repository URL”框中,输入你要加载的GitHub项目的HTTPS或SSH链接。
- HTTPS链接示例:
https://github.com/username/repo.git
- SSH链接示例:
git@github.com:username/repo.git
3.4 选择本地目录
在“Directory”框中,选择一个本地文件夹,IDEA会在该文件夹中下载GitHub项目。
3.5 点击克隆
点击“Clone”按钮,IDEA将会开始克隆该项目。完成后,IDEA会自动打开该项目。
4. 常见问题解答
4.1 如何解决加载GitHub项目时的错误?
- 确保URL正确:检查输入的GitHub项目链接是否正确。
- 网络问题:确保你的网络连接正常。
- GitHub访问权限:如果项目是私有的,需要确认你是否有访问权限。可以通过在IDEA中设置GitHub账户来解决。
4.2 如何在IDEA中配置GitHub账户?
- 打开IDEA,选择“File” -> “Settings”。
- 在左侧栏中选择“Version Control” -> “GitHub”。
- 输入你的GitHub用户名和密码,或者通过OAuth进行身份验证。
4.3 加载GitHub项目后,如何管理版本控制?
- 提交更改:使用IDEA的版本控制面板提交你的更改。
- 拉取和推送:可以直接通过IDEA进行拉取和推送操作,确保你的代码是最新的。
5. 加载GitHub项目后的常见操作
5.1 代码编辑和调试
IDEA提供丰富的编辑功能,支持智能代码补全、重构、调试等。你可以轻松地进行代码编辑和调试。
5.2 使用插件提升功能
可以根据需要安装各种插件,以增强IDEA的功能。例如,安装CodeGlance可以在代码编辑器旁边显示代码的缩略图,提升开发效率。
5.3 进行版本控制
使用IDEA的版本控制系统(VCS)功能,可以轻松地管理你的代码版本,查看提交历史,合并分支等。
6. 小结
通过以上步骤,你可以顺利地在IDEA中加载GitHub项目。无论是个人项目还是团队协作,IDEA都能够帮助你提高开发效率。希望本文能够帮助你更好地使用IDEA进行项目开发。
如有进一步的问题,欢迎留言交流!